l cant believe you really think the air pipe will just stick up out of the ground with a sign on it saying air pipe for secret bunker
it will be hidden obviously or it wouldn't be a secret bunker
my first thoughts were to pipe back to the workshop underground and come up under the floor slab and emerge inside the workshop heater which looks more or less like this

Image

except mine has filters all round the bottom which filter the air for the burner, now i wasent thinking of using the heater part of it just having the pipes inside the filters so they cant be seen that way i can use them to filter the air plus use the motor to drive the air into the bunker giving positve pressure, although its more likely i will just mount 12v electric fans within the heater so it all still works if the power goes out
